Transaction 0337751e77809bd408d409815d8c6b9962f32783f157e588b429212a41dfbb65
2 Input
2 Outputs
- 0337751e77809bd408d409815d8c6b9962f32783f157e588b429212a41dfbb65:0
- 0337751e77809bd408d409815d8c6b9962f32783f157e588b429212a41dfbb65:1
value 3598021
address 1EQD4pE5CebBXRMJintsg6yXsNz3wKJJrm
value 100000000
address 1DaXYYqRJGzFTrshRVng7bpMFbBQeGbNQF